A is for Anthropology: Uncovering Skeletal Secrets
Forensic anthropology plays a crucial role in identifying human remains. Anthropologists analyze skeletal structures to determine age, sex, ancestry, and even cause of death. This field requires a deep understanding of human anatomy and the effects of decomposition.
B is for Bloodstain Pattern Analysis: Interpreting the Spatter
Bloodstain pattern analysis (BPA) is a crucial aspect of crime scene investigation. By analyzing the shape, size, and distribution of bloodstains, investigators can reconstruct events, determine the type of weapon used, and even identify the position of the victim and assailant. This requires meticulous observation and a strong understanding of fluid dynamics.
C is for Criminalistics: The Broad Field of Forensic Science
Criminalistics encompasses a wide range of forensic disciplines, including trace evidence analysis, firearms examination, and questioned document examination. It's the application of scientific methods to criminal investigations, requiring a multifaceted skillset and often involves collaboration with experts from various fields.
D is for DNA Analysis: The Gold Standard of Identification
DNA analysis has revolutionized forensic science. Through techniques like PCR (polymerase chain reaction) and DNA profiling, investigators can identify individuals from minute traces of biological material, linking suspects to crime scenes with remarkable accuracy. This sophisticated technology requires highly specialized training and equipment.
E is for Entomology: Insects as Evidence
Forensic entomology utilizes the study of insects to aid in investigations, particularly in determining the time of death. The types and life cycles of insects found on a body can provide valuable clues about the post-mortem interval (PMI), helping to narrow down the timeframe of a crime.
F is for Fingerprinting: The Classic Identification Technique
Fingerprint identification remains a cornerstone of forensic science. Based on the unique pattern of ridges and valleys on fingertips, fingerprints can definitively identify individuals, providing irrefutable evidence in criminal investigations. This technique relies on meticulous comparison and analysis.
G is for Genetics: Understanding Inheritance Patterns
Understanding basic genetic principles is fundamental to forensic genetics. Knowledge of inheritance patterns and allele frequencies is crucial for interpreting DNA evidence and determining the probability of a match.
H is for Histology: Microscopic Examination of Tissues
Histology, the study of tissues, is a vital tool in forensic pathology. Microscopic examination of tissues can reveal the presence of toxins, diseases, or injuries that may contribute to determining the cause of death.
I is for Impression Evidence: Footprints, Tire Tracks, and More
Impression evidence, such as footprints, tire tracks, and tool marks, can provide valuable information about the movements of individuals and vehicles at a crime scene. Casting and analysis of these impressions can be crucial in reconstructing events.
J is for Jurisprudence: The Legal Framework of Forensic Science
Forensic science operates within a legal framework, and understanding jurisprudence is essential for ensuring the admissibility of evidence in court. This includes understanding chain of custody and legal standards for scientific evidence.
K is for Toxicology: Detecting Poisons and Drugs
Forensic toxicology involves the detection and identification of drugs, poisons, and other toxins in biological samples. This analysis can be crucial in determining the cause of death or establishing the presence of impairing substances.
L is for Luminol: Revealing Hidden Bloodstains
Luminol is a chemical reagent used to detect traces of blood at crime scenes, even if the blood has been cleaned or diluted. Its luminescent reaction helps investigators locate potentially crucial evidence.
M is for Microscopy: Examining Tiny Details
Microscopy plays a critical role in examining trace evidence, such as fibers, hairs, and paint chips. Different types of microscopes allow for detailed analysis of these microscopic clues.
N is for Narcotics Analysis: Identifying Illegal Substances
Narcotics analysis involves identifying and quantifying illegal drugs seized during investigations. This helps establish the nature and quantity of the drugs involved in a crime.
O is for Odontology: Identifying Individuals Through Teeth
Forensic odontology uses dental records to identify victims in mass disasters or cases where bodies are severely decomposed. Unique dental features can provide a reliable means of identification.
P is for Pathology: Determining Cause of Death
Forensic pathology is the branch of medicine that focuses on determining the cause and manner of death. Pathologists conduct autopsies to investigate injuries, diseases, and other factors that contributed to death.
Q is for Questioned Documents: Examining Handwriting and Authenticity
Questioned document examination involves analyzing handwriting, signatures, and other documents to determine authenticity and authorship. This can be crucial in forgery investigations.
R is for Radiology: Imaging Techniques in Forensic Science
Radiology employs imaging techniques like X-rays and CT scans to visualize injuries, internal structures, and foreign objects within the body, assisting in forensic investigations.
S is for Serology: Analysis of Body Fluids
Serology involves the analysis of body fluids like blood, semen, and saliva to identify and characterize them. This often plays a significant role in sexual assault investigations.
T is for Trace Evidence: Microscopic Clues at the Scene
Trace evidence encompasses minute materials transferred during the commission of a crime, including fibers, hairs, paint chips, and glass fragments. Careful collection and analysis of trace evidence is crucial.
U is for UV Photography: Enhancing Evidence Visibility
UV photography utilizes ultraviolet light to enhance the visibility of certain types of evidence, such as body fluids or latent fingerprints, which might otherwise be invisible to the naked eye.
V is for Voice Analysis: Identifying Speakers
Voice analysis can be used to identify individuals based on their unique vocal characteristics. This technique can be helpful in cases involving threatening phone calls or recorded messages.
W is for Weaponry Analysis: Examining Firearms and Tools
Weaponry analysis involves examining firearms, tools, and other weapons to determine their functionality, and potential links to a crime. This analysis often involves ballistic testing and tool mark analysis.
X is for X-ray Diffraction: Analyzing Crystalline Materials
X-ray diffraction is a technique used to analyze the crystalline structure of materials, which can be helpful in identifying substances found at a crime scene.
Y is for Y-STR Analysis: Identifying Male DNA
Y-STR analysis focuses on the Y chromosome, which is passed down from father to son. This technique is particularly useful in sexual assault cases, where it can help identify male contributors to mixed DNA samples.
Z is for Zoology: Animal Evidence in Crime Scenes
Forensic zoology involves the analysis of animal evidence found at crime scenes, which can provide valuable context and information. This includes analyzing animal hairs, feathers, and other remains.

forensic science a to z challenge: Wrongful Convictions and Forensic Science Errors John Morgan, 2023-03-29 Forensic Science Errors and Wrongful Convictions: Case Studies and Root Causes provides a rigorous and detailed examination of two key issues: the continuing problem of wrongful convictions and the role of forensic science in these miscarriages of justice. This comprehensive textbook covers the full breadth of the topic. It looks at each type of evidence, historical factors, system issues, organizational factors, and individual examiners. Forensic science errors may arise at any time from crime scene to courtroom. Probative evidence may be overlooked at the scene of a crime, or the chain of custody may be compromised. Police investigators may misuse or ignore forensic evidence. A poorly-trained examiner may not apply the accepted standards of the discipline or may make unsound interpretations that exceed the limits of generally accepted scientific knowledge. In the courtroom, the forensic scientist may testify outside the standards of the discipline or fail to present exculpatory results. Prosecutors may suppress or mischaracterize evidence, and judges may admit testimony that does not conform to rules of evidence. All too often, the accused will not be afforded an adequate defense—especially given the technical complexities of forensic evidence. These issues do not arise in a vacuum; they result from system issues that are discernable and can be ameliorated. Author John Morgan provides a thorough discussion of the policy, practice, and technical aspects of forensic science errors from a root-cause, scientific analysis perspective. Readers will learn to analyze common issues across cases and jurisdictions, perform basic root cause analysis, and develop systemic reforms. The reader is encouraged to assess cases and issues without regard to preconceived views or prejudicial language. As such, the book reinforces the need to obtain a clear understanding of errors to properly develop a set of effective scientific, procedural, and policy reforms to reduce wrongful convictions and improve forensic integrity and reliability. Written in a format and style accessible to a broad audience, Forensic Science Errors and Wrongful Convictions presents a thorough analysis across all of these issues, supported by detailed case studies and a clear understanding of the scientific basis of the forensic disciplines. |
